Tirreno-Adriatico 2009
Stage 3
Fucecchio → Santa Croce sull'Arno
Stage Profile & Data
Stage 3 of the 2009 Tirreno-Adriatico, held on March 13, 2009, covered 166.0 km from Fucecchio to Santa Croce sull'Arno. Classified as a flat stage suited for sprinters. The riders faced 1,297 meters of total elevation gain, one of the flattest stages in the edition. The stage was completed at an average speed of 42.6 km/h, which was 2.1 km/h faster than the edition average of 40.5 km/h, ranking as the 2nd fastest stage of the race.
